Newfoundland & Labrador Class 5 Knowledge Test · Question

What is the typical maximum speed limit on highways in Newfoundland and Labrador, unless otherwise posted?

The typical maximum speed limit on highways in Newfoundland and Labrador is 100 km/h, unless signs indicate otherwise.
